- Title
Editorial: 9/11, Global Terrorism and Health.
- Authors
Twemlow, Stuart W.; Sacco, Frank C.; Ramzy, Nadia
- Abstract
The authors comment on the psychological impact of the September 11 terrorist attacks on the health of survivors. They highlight the prevalence of post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) symptoms among the survivors. They assert the need to provide mental health services for this group of population. The role of communities in preventive approaches for psychological problems is noted.
